Transaction 95b473cc81cc63c44329bddd1182090a17b438a28a3d055147daea21d10a9d93

1 Input
1 Outputs
  • 95b473cc81cc63c44329bddd1182090a17b438a28a3d055147daea21d10a9d93:0
  • value  1898989
    address  38oSbtfjs12qLgzaHvFaf9dyn7EryqhDsy